10+ Free AI Courses by Google

Pankaj Singh Last Updated : 07 Mar, 2024
10 min read

Introduction

Nowadays, learning about AI is the ask of the hour. With new AI technologies coming out regularly, everyone is buzzing about AI. As technology advances rapidly, a solid understanding of artificial intelligence and machine learning is crucial for staying competitive in the job market.

Picture this: a world where understanding artificial intelligence and machine learning is not just a skill but a necessity for career competitiveness. As technology progresses, it’s time to equip yourself with the knowledge that will set you apart in the job market.

Guess what? The tech powerhouse, Google, has your back! They’ve curated a collection of free AI courses that cater to everyone, whether you’re a coding novice or an experienced programmer looking to level up. These courses are like a virtual playground, offering diverse topics, from the basics of machine learning to the intricacies of natural language processing.

These courses cover various topics, from machine learning to natural language processing, and are designed to help individuals enhance their skills and knowledge in AI. If you are struggling to find one, this article is for you.

Read on to know more!

AI Courses by Google

Benefits of Taking Google AI Courses

There are several potential benefits to taking Google AI courses, which can be broadly categorized into career-oriented and knowledge-based advantages:

Career Benefits

  • Skill development: Free AI courses by Google can equip you with the skills and knowledge necessary to enter the field of Artificial Intelligence (AI) or Machine Learning (ML). These skills are highly sought-after in today’s job market, opening doors to various career opportunities across healthcare, finance, and technology industries.
  • Increased employability: A recognized credential from Google AI, even a free course completion certificate, can make you a more attractive candidate to potential employers. It demonstrates your interest and initiative in learning in-demand skills.
  • Staying ahead of the curve: AI is a rapidly evolving field. Taking Google AI courses can help you stay updated on the latest advancements and trends, ensuring you possess relevant knowledge for the job market.

Knowledge-based Benefits

  • Improved understanding of AI: Even if you are not aiming for a career in AI, taking Google AI courses can enhance your general understanding of how AI works and its impact on various aspects of our lives. This knowledge can be valuable in various personal and professional contexts.
  • Critical thinking and problem-solving skills: Many AI courses involve hands-on learning and practical application of concepts. This can help you develop critical thinking and problem-solving skills, valuable assets in any field.
  • Enhanced decision-making: By understanding AI’s capabilities and limitations, you can make more informed decisions in various personal and professional situations.

It’s important to note that the benefits you gain from Google AI courses will depend on your goals and chosen course. However, the potential benefits listed above highlight the value proposition of these courses for anyone interested in learning more about AI and its applications.

Also read: A Complete Python Tutorial to Learn Data Science from Scratch.

Course 1: Introduction to Large Language Models

Large Language Models

This micro-learning course introduces Large Language Models (LLM), delving into their definitions, potential applications, and prompt tuning techniques to optimize LLM performance. It also guides you using Google tools to create your own Generation AI applications.

You’ll be eligible to receive the displayed badge upon completing the course. Keep track of all your earned badges on your profile page. Showcase the skills you’ve acquired and elevate your cloud career by demonstrating your expertise to the world!

Objective of Course

  1. Define what Large Language Models (LLMs) are.
  2. Provide an overview of Use Cases for Large Language Models (LLMs).
  3. Elaborate on the concept of Prompt Tuning.
  4. Explain the development tools in Google’s Gen AI toolkit.

Course 2: Introduction to Generative AI

AI Courses by Google

This microlearning course introduces Generative AI, offering insights into its definition, applications, and distinctions from conventional machine learning approaches. Additionally, it delves into using Google Tools to create your own Generative AI applications.

Upon completing this course, you’ll be eligible to receive the badge showcased here! Keep track of all your earned badges on your profile page. Elevate your cloud career by showcasing the skills you’ve cultivated!

Objective of Course

  1. Define Generative AI.
  2. Elaborate on the functioning of Generative AI.
  3. Outline various types of Generative AI models.
  4. Discuss the applications of Generative AI.

Course 3: Introduction to Responsible AI

AI Courses by Google

This microlearning course serves as an entry-level guide designed to clarify the concept of responsible AI, its significance, and Google’s approach to implementing responsible AI in its products. The course also provides an overview of Google’s 7 AI principles.

Upon completing this course, you’ll be awarded the displayed badge. Track and showcase all your earned badges on your profile page. Enhance your standing in the cloud industry by showcasing the skills you’ve acquired!

Objective of Course

  1. Gain insight into the rationale behind Google’s implementation of AI principles.
  2. Identify the imperative for fostering a responsible AI approach within organizational practices.
  3. Acknowledge the consequential impact of decisions made throughout all project phases on responsible AI.
  4. Recognize the flexibility for organizations to tailor AI designs to align with their unique business requirements and values.

Course 4: Generative AI Fundamentals

AI Courses by Google

Achieve a skill badge by successfully finishing the courses Introduction to Generative AI, Introduction to Large Language Models, and Introduction to Responsible AI. Upon passing the final quiz, you’ll showcase your grasp of fundamental concepts in generative AI.

A skill badge issued by Google Cloud acknowledges your proficiency in their products and services. Make your profile public and add the badge to your social media to share your accomplishments.

Upon course completion, you’ll receive the displayed badge. Track all your earned badges on your profile page. Enhance your cloud career by highlighting the skills you’ve honed to the world!

Objective of Course

  1. Successfully finish the course named “Introduction to Generative AI.”
  2. Complete the course “Introduction to Large Language Models (LLM).”
  3. Successfully finish the course named “Introduction to Responsible AI.”
  4. Achieve a passing score on the “Generative AI Fundamentals” quiz to earn the skill badge.

Also, the GenAI Pinnacle Program, a groundbreaking initiative is reshaping the landscape of AI education. This avant-garde course sets the stage for unparalleled learning and development in artificial intelligence, ensuring you stay at the forefront of this dynamic field. Explore this today!

Course 5: Introduction to Generative AI Studio

AI Courses by Google

This course will familiarize you with Generative AI Studio, a tool on Vertex AI designed to assist you in prototyping and customizing generative AI models for integration into your applications. Throughout the course, you will gain an understanding of what Generative AI Studio entails, explore its features and functionalities, and learn how to navigate through the product via hands-on demonstrations. A quiz will be provided after the course to assess your comprehension.

You will be awarded a badge upon successful completion, which you can showcase on your profile page alongside other earned badges. Elevate your cloud career by highlighting the skills you’ve honed through this course!

Objective of Course

  1. Provide an overview of the functionalities of Generative AI Studio.
  2. Detail the available options within Generative AI Studio.
  3. Investigate the language tool features offered by Generative AI Studio.

Course 6: Create Image Captioning Models

AI Courses by Google

In this course, you will gain the skills to construct an image captioning model through deep learning techniques. You’ll explore key elements like the encoder and decoder and learn how to train and assess your model effectively. By the course’s conclusion, you can craft your own image captioning models to generate descriptive captions for various images.

You’ll be eligible to earn the displayed badge upon completing the course. Keep track of all your earned badges on your profile page, showcasing the valuable skills you’ve acquired. Elevate your cloud computing career by demonstrating your expertise to the world!

Objective of Course

  1. Gain insight into the various elements comprising an image captioning model.
  2. Acquire the skills to train and assess the performance of an image captioning model.
  3. Develop personalized image captioning models.
  4. Apply your custom image captioning models to produce captions for images.

Course 7: Transformer Models and BERT Model

AI Courses by Google

This course introduces you to the Transformer architecture and the Bidirectional Encoder Representations from the Transformers (BERT) model. You’ll gain insights into the key elements of the Transformer architecture, including the self-attention mechanism, and understand how it forms the basis of the BERT model. Additionally, you’ll explore various applications of BERT, such as text classification, question answering, and natural language inference.

Completing this course is expected to take around 45 minutes. Once finished, you’ll be eligible to earn the displayed badge. Keep track of all your earned badges on your profile page. Showcase your developed skills to the world and enhance your cloud career!

Objective of Course

  1. Gain insight into the key elements of the Transformer architecture.
  2. Acquire knowledge on constructing a BERT model with Transformers.
  3. Apply BERT to address various natural language processing (NLP) challenges.

Course 8: Attention Mechanism

AI Courses by Google

In this course, you’ll explore the attention mechanism—an influential technique empowering neural networks to concentrate on particular segments of an input sequence. Gain insights into how attention operates and discover its applications in enhancing the efficiency of diverse machine learning tasks such as machine translation, text summarization, and question answering.

Expect to invest around 45 minutes in completing this course.

Upon successful completion, you’ll be eligible for the displayed badge. Highlight the badges you’ve earned on your profile page to showcase your acquired skills and boost your cloud career easily. Let the world recognize the expertise you’ve cultivated!

Objective of Course

  1. Gain a comprehensive understanding of the concept of attention and its functioning.
  2. Acquire knowledge on applying attention mechanisms in the context of machine translation.

Moreover, in this journey of continuous learning, the Certified AI & ML BlackBelt PlusProgram emerges as a beacon, offering a tailor-made approach to mastering the intricacies of Artificial Intelligence and Machine Learning.

Imagine a learning experience where every lesson is meticulously designed to align with your career goals. The PlusProgram not only provides an in-depth understanding of AI and ML but also caters to your unique aspirations, ensuring a curriculum that propels you towards success.

Course 9: Encoder-Decoder Architecture

AI Courses by Google

This course provides an overview of the encoder-decoder architecture, a robust machine learning framework widely used for sequence-to-sequence tasks like machine translation, text summarization, and question answering. You will gain insights into the key elements of the encoder-decoder setup and the skills to train and deploy these models. In the practical lab session, you’ll use TensorFlow to create a basic implementation of the encoder-decoder architecture for generating poetry from scratch.

Upon completing this course, you can earn the displayed badge. Track all your earned badges on your profile page and enhance your cloud career by showcasing your newly acquired skills to the world!

Objective of Course

  1. Comprehend the fundamental elements of the encoder-decoder architecture.
  2. Acquire the skills to train and produce text from a model employing the encoder-decoder architecture.
  3. Develop the ability to create your encoder-decoder model using Keras.

Course 10: Introduction to Image Generation

AI Courses by Google

This course will familiarize you with diffusion models, a group of machine-learning models that have recently shown promise in image generation. Principles from physics, particularly thermodynamics, inspire these models. Over the past few years, diffusion models have gained popularity in research and industry, serving as the foundation for many cutting-edge image generation models and tools available on Google Cloud. The course covers the theoretical aspects of diffusion models and practical training and deployment techniques on Vertex AI.

Upon completing this course, you’ll have the opportunity to earn a badge, which will be showcased on your profile page. Displaying the badges you’ve earned is a great way to boost your cloud career, highlighting the valuable skills you’ve acquired throughout the course.

Objective of Course

  1. Understanding the mechanics of diffusion models
  2. Exploring practical applications of diffusion models
  3. Examining diffusion models without constraints
  4. Investigating progress in diffusion models, particularly in the context of text-to-image conversion.

Also read: Top 7 Generative AI Courses to Do in 2024

Course 11: Responsible AI: Applying AI Principles with Google Cloud

AI Courses by Google

As the adoption of enterprise Artificial Intelligence (AI) and Machine Learning (ML) grows, implementing them responsibly becomes increasingly important. However, translating the concept of responsible AI into practical application poses a challenge for many. If you’re eager to understand how to integrate responsible AI practices within your organization effectively, this course is designed for you.

Throughout this course, you will gain insights into Google Cloud’s current practices, valuable best practices, and lessons learned. These will serve as a comprehensive framework for establishing your responsible AI approach.

Upon completing this course, you can earn the displayed badge, showcasing your achievement. Keep track of all your earned badges on your profile page and enhance your cloud career by demonstrating the skills you’ve acquired to the world!

Objective of Course

  1. Elaborate on the rationale behind responsible AI in a business context
  2. Recognize ethical concerns related to AI by employing effective issue-spotting techniques
  3. Illustrate the implementation of Google’s AI Principles and utilize insights gained from their experiences
  4. Apply a framework for integrating responsible AI practices within your organization
  5. Explore subsequent actions to advance your commitment to responsible AI implementation

Miscellaneous Learning Options by Google

Explore technical training options if you’re an application developer, database engineer, integration engineer, or security engineer:

  1. The Arcade: Gain hands-on knowledge in the Google Cloud environment through generative AI labs in this gamified experience. Earn points for Google Cloud swag.

    Link: Arcade by Google.
  2. Gen AI Bootcamp: Access on-demand workshops covering foundational to advanced topics. Beginners can follow step-by-step, while experienced developers can dive into advanced sessions.

    Link: Gen AI Bootcamp.
  3. What is Codey? Learn in 60 seconds: Discover how Codey helps you bring your coding ideas to life in just one minute, making coding accessible even for beginners.

    Link: Codey.

Conclusion

In conclusion, free AI courses by Google offer a valuable opportunity for individuals to enhance their skills and knowledge in artificial intelligence. Whether you’re a beginner looking to learn the basics or an experienced coder seeking to expand your expertise, these courses provide a wealth of valuable information that can help you succeed in the ever-evolving world of AI. Take advantage of these free resources and start your AI education journey today!

Hi, I am Pankaj Singh Negi - Senior Content Editor | Passionate about storytelling and crafting compelling narratives that transform ideas into impactful content. I love reading about technology revolutionizing our lifestyle.

Responses From Readers

Clear

We use cookies essential for this site to function well. Please click to help us improve its usefulness with additional cookies. Learn about our use of cookies in our Privacy Policy & Cookies Policy.

Show details